You are responsible for ensuring your study permit is still valid during your studies in Canada. To keep your immigration status valid, you must keep track of your study validity. Suppose your permit is about to expire before you complete your study program. You must apply to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) to extend your student visa to Canada before that date. This is called applying for extending study permit in Canada (renewal) of your status as a student. You must be living in Canada to be eligible for an extension.

How long before I should apply to extend student visa Canada?

It is recommended that international students apply for an extension three to four months before the current permit expires if they want to extend their study permit. If you submit your application early enough, you can stay in Canada until you hear back from the IRCC under the terms of your current one. 

Can I work if I apply to renew study permit?

You can stay in the country if you apply for extending study permit in Canada before it expires. This is because you’ve maintained your current status. If you haven’t received your new permit, stay in Canada and don’t leave. This indicates that you will only be a temporary resident while IRCC considers your application. You can continue to study and work off-campus until a decision is made on your application. This is known as “Implied Status.” 

First, you should verify the expiration date on your passport. Your permit’s validity period cannot exceed the duration of your passport. Because of this, you should ensure that your passport validity is longer than the duration you request on your application. 

You lost your status in Canada if you didn’t apply to renew your permit before its expiration. You must restore your status and apply for a new one before you can resume or continue your studies. There are two choices for extending student visa Canada, either applying on paper or online: 

How to renew permit in Canada on paper?

If you submit a paper application, you must complete and sign the applicable forms, include all required supporting documents, provide evidence that your application fees have been paid, and deliver your package to the IRCC processing center’s mail address. Make sure you fill out the application form, the document checklist, and the supporting documents if you apply on paper. The step-by-step IRCC instructions make completing the form and attaching supporting documentation easier. Because applications on paper take longer to process, it is not advised. 

How to renew a permit in Canada online?

When you apply online, you’ll fill out a questionnaire, make a personal checklist code, register for or connect to your MYCIC account, and instantly get a list of the required application forms and supporting documentation. The forms must be printed, filled out, signed, and scanned. After that, you must upload them to your IRCC account with all required supporting files. Additionally, you will have to use a credit card to pay the fee online. Online applications provide quicker processing times and greater convenience. 

ARNIKA VISA would recommend you apply online, as processing times are always quicker than when applying on paper.  

How long does it take to renew a permit in Canada?

Since the application procedure could take several months, submitting your application as soon as possible is crucial. Verify study visa extension processing time at the IRCC processing times website. It is updated every week. If your application is approved, your Permit will be mailed to you at the address you provided to the CIC. 

How much does it cost to extend student visa Canada?

There’s a CAN$ 200 fee to restore your status and a CAN$ 150 fee for the new permit. If you are required to submit biometrics, you must pay an additional fee of $85.

Documents required for study permit extension in Canada

  • Application form: The application to Change Conditions, renew my status or Continue to Study in Canada [IMM5709]  is a study permit extension form.
  •  UCI: If you already have a study and work permit, it will say UCI, sometimes known as “Client ID.” 
  • Document Number: On study or work permits, the document number begins with a letter (F or U), then nine numbers. 
  • Valid Passport: If your passport is about to expire, renew it six months beforehand. 
  • Proof of financial support while studying in Canada: Study Visa extension proof of funds must be a bank statement, bank draft, or other evidence that demonstrates you have enough money (in Canadian dollars) to sustain yourself while studying in Canada, including school tuition + CAD 10,000 (for living expenses). Include their letter of support and documentation proving sufficient cash in their name if a family member, organization, or other entity is paying for your education. If your spouse is travelling with you to Canada, you must show proof of an extra $4,000 and $3,000 for each additional dependent. 
  • Proof of current/upcoming enrolment: Graduate students must complete this form to request a letter confirming their enrollment and anticipated graduation date. 
  • Letter of Acceptance: (Letter of Enrollment/registration for returning students) International students returning to the university must present a letter from the registrar’s office confirming their enrollment or registration. Only those enrolling directly from a Canadian high school or transferring from another university must submit an acceptance letter. Send the Letter Request Form to have the letter posted or made available for pick-up. 
  • Proof of Medical Exam (if Applicable): You are only required to present evidence of a medical exam if you have had one performed within the previous 12 months by a CIC-authorized panel physician (doctor) or if you have spent more than six months living in a designated country or territory within the last 12 months. 
  • An explanation letter: You might need to attach an explanatory note or additional support from your faculty in some circumstances. If you need to submit these other documents with your application, it is encouraged that you speak with an RCIC first. 
  • Client details (Optional): Include a letter of justification and supplementary papers to strengthen your case. 

Can I extend my co-op work permit?

If you are a student enrolled in a co-op program, you can apply for a extend study permit in Canada (if it is due to expire) and your co-op work permit using a single application form. 

What happens after a permit extension approval?

Before approving your application, an IRCC officer will determine whether you have complied with the requirements of your permit. You will be notified through email and have a letter in your online account if the officer needs extra documentation to make their decision. Before the deadline, you must respond; otherwise, your application will be rejected. You can send an inquiry using the IRCC Web Form if your application takes longer than the current IRCC processing times. You’ll get a letter in your online account when your extension application is approved. The permit will be mailed to your Canadian mailing address by IRCC. After receiving your new permit, you can apply for a new Temporary Resident Visa if you require one to travel abroad.

How do I restore my status as a student in Canada?

You must immediately stop studying and working and visit the RCIC for help if you don’t apply for extending study permit in Canada before it expires. Within 90 days of losing your status, you can request to have it restored from within Canada. The processing period can last many months and varies. Your application to reg restore your situation is not guaranteed to be approved. Until you hear from IRCC regarding the outcome of your application, you are not permitted to leave the country. You cannot apply to restore your status from outside of Canada

How long can I stay in Canada after a permit expires?

You must leave the country and apply for a new study permit from your home country if more than 90 days have passed since the expiration date of your permit and you haven’t requested its restoration. Your application to renew your study permit could be subject to a 6-month ban. To acquire guidance on gathering the necessary documents before departing the country, consult the Regulated Canadian Immigration Consultant (RCIC) immediately. 

You cannot continue studying or working if your permit has expired. Following expiration, you will still have 90 days to apply for a “restoration of status.” The procedure is the same as renewing the permit. However, there are $200 more costs. Each member of your family who lost their status is subject to this cost. 

You must explain why you must remain after your current one expires and why you did not apply before it expired. Of course, it is assumed that you have been admitted to a Designated Learning Institution for this application to restore status. 

If you stay in Canada after your permit expires for over 90 days, you’ll undoubtedly be prohibited from returning for a while. So, if you have a letter of acceptance to continue your studies in Canada, you should leave before the 90-day window closes and reapply.

What are study permit conditions in Canada?

All permit holders in Canada are required to actively pursue their studies, which means they must continue to be enrolled and make steady progress toward finishing their programs. If you don’t, you risk being removed from Canada. Ninety days after you finish your studies, your study visa expires. Your program is deemed completed when you get written confirmation from the Registrar’s Office (such as an official letter). 

Can I change my program, college, or university?

You can change between programs and institutions if you have a current study permit for post-secondary education. However, you must notify CIC via their MyCIC account if you are changing designated learning institutions.
